Tonight was a heavy night at CrossFit Swift.
The workout was thrusters 3-3-3-3-3. So of course Mason and I set up on the same bar. I just have to compete with someone and I prefer it to be someone better than me. That makes Mason the logical choice.
The first couple of rounds were surprisingly easy. We started at 135lbs then 145lbs then 155lbs. It was interesting watching Mason struggle with the front squat and then explode with the push press fairly easily. With me it was the exact opposite. The front squats were a piece of cake. Then I began to struggle with the push press.

On the 4th round we stepped up to 165lbs. I knew I was going to struggle with this one. Again the front squat was easy but then I had to press it overhead. I was able to get out 2 of the 3 reps but that was it. Now came the 5th round. Mason wanted to go up to 175lbs. Of course I had to at least try it. I knew it was a shot in the dark but what the heck. Down I went with the front squat - piece of cake - but there was no way that push press was going anywhere.

I backed it back down to 170lbs just to see if I could get one rep. Yes I did and it felt good and that is where I stopped.

Here are my numbers for the evening.

Thrusters
3-3-3-3-3
135-145-155-165(2)-170(1)
